In today’s exciting conversation, Ari and Daniel Raz discuss the importance of fitness, nutrition, and mindset in achieving health goals. Daniel, an online fitness trainer, emphasizes the convenience of home workouts, the significance of consistency, and the balance between enjoying food and maintaining a healthy diet. They explore the long-term approach to fitness, the role of strength training versus cardio, and the transferable skills gained through fitness.
